Penetration Quotes


Almost all Iraqis with any previous experience in the intelligence business are Sunni Arab, increasing the risk of penetration of the new intelligence apparatus by the insurgency.
Wayne White

Another dynamic of this last year was our increased penetration into the Japanese market.
David Milne

Internet penetration in Italy is quite low and the Berlusconi media machine controls most of what people see.
Joichi Ito

The essence of the stage is concentration and penetration. Of the screen action, movement, sweep.
Elia Kazan

The first stage in a technology's advance is that it'll fall below a critical price. After it falls below a critical price, it will tend, if it's successful, to rise above a critical mass, a penetration.
Chris Anderson

There is an underlying, fundamental reliance on the Internet, which continues to grow in the number of users, country penetration and both fixed and wireless broadband access.
Vinton Cerf

To succeed in the world, it is much more necessary to possess the penetration to discern who is a fool, than to discover who is a clever man.
Charles Maurice de Talleyrand

Wisdom and penetration are the fruit of experience, not the lessons of retirement and leisure. Great necessities call out great virtues.
Abigail Adams
